A big birthday thank you to Susie and Dad for sending me a new ornament for my tree. (The one on the right.)

Yes, my friends, that is Henry the VIII on the left. In the middle is Ms. Anne Boleyn (beheaded), and the latest edition is Ms. Catherine of Aragon (divorced).
Oh, you need an explanation... ? Okay.
I went to London for 10 days with my dad and brother back in the summer of '99. I found these Henry VIII ornaments in Windsor and fell in love. You could buy Henry and all six of his unfortunate wives, plus his daughter Elizabeth I. They were just soooo funny to me! But, being a poor student back then, I could only afford Henry. So poor Henry has been all alone for these many years until now. Dad and Susie went to London this summer and brought back Anne for me. And then they surprised me for my birthday with Catherine. Only four more to go... (I wonder if Henry ever had those exact thoughts?)
And why Henry, you wonder? Henry VIII was awesome! I mean, he was just so full of himself, so confident, so crazy, so narcissistic, and yet so charismatic that he got just about everyone who mattered to go along with his crazy schemes. Not only did he go through six wives because none of them gave him a son who lived, he also taxed people like crazy and liked to fight with the French for no reason. (And who doesn't, I say.) Plus, and this is my favorite, he decided to start his own church (the Church of England), force everyone in the country to convert, and make himself the head of it because the Pope excommunicated him for divorcing one of his wives. Awesome.
Okay, not exactly hero material. But definitely one of the most interesting figures in world history. At least to me. And since this is my blog, that's all that really matters. :)
